JOACHIM v. AMC MULTI-CINEMA, INC.

14728 101417/12

129 A.D.3d 433 (2015)

11 N.Y.S.3d 119

2015 NY Slip Op 04731

BRIGITTA JOACHIM, Respondent, v. AMC MULTI-CINEMA, INC., et al., Appellants.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, First Department.

Decided June 4, 2015.


Order, Supreme Court, New York County (Paul Wooten, J.), entered July 8, 2014, which, inter alia, denied defendants' motion for summary judgment dismissing the complaint, unanimously affirmed, without costs.

[Prior Case History: 2014 NY Slip Op 31749(U).]
